On 18/06/2014 01:25, Stephen Harrison wrote:
> There is a good treatment of errors in the CORDIC algorithm due to
> finite word length in this paper from IEEE transactions: The
> Quantization Effects of the CORDIC Algorithm (Yu Hen Hu, Senior Member,
> IEEE). I reproduced the results of section IV fairly easily a while ago.
> There are numerical errors in both amplitude and phase but you are
> right, this is not the cause of the frequency offset you observe.
Just for the sake of academic discussion (and without having read the
paper): any amplitude error can be seen as a phase error, however in
this specific case I would expect those to have the same periodicity of
the generate sine wave. Therefore they cannot account for a frequency
error. Am I wrong?
